Tipik bir vin\u00e7 k\u00f6pr\u00fcs\u00fcn\u00fcn ana bile\u015fenlerini, aksesuarlar\u0131n\u0131 ve montajlar\u0131n\u0131 a\u00e7\u0131klar. \u0130ster operat\u00f6r, ister bak\u0131m i\u015f\u00e7isi olun, ister sekt\u00f6re yeni ad\u0131m atm\u0131\u015f olun, bu makale her bir par\u00e7an\u0131n g\u00fcnl\u00fck kullan\u0131m, bak\u0131m ve sorun giderme i\u00e7in i\u015flevini ve \u00f6nemini anlaman\u0131za yard\u0131mc\u0131 olacakt\u0131r.<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"1200\" height=\"800\" src=\"https:\/\/www.hndfcrane.com\/wp-content\/uploads\/2025\/06\/Overhead-Crane-Parts-1.jpg\" alt=\"\" class=\"wp-image-12360\"\/><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"overhead-crane-frame\">K\u00f6pr\u00fcl\u00fc Vin\u00e7 \u00c7er\u00e7evesi<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"main-girder\">Ana Kiri\u015f<\/h3>\n\n\n\n<p>Ana kiri\u015f, bir k\u00f6pr\u00fcl\u00fc vincin \u00e7ekirdek y\u00fck ta\u015f\u0131y\u0131c\u0131 yap\u0131s\u0131d\u0131r. Genellikle y\u00fcksek mukavemetli \u00e7elikten yap\u0131l\u0131r ve a\u011f\u0131r y\u00fckler alt\u0131nda stabiliteyi garanti ederek b\u00fck\u00fclmeye ve burulmaya kar\u015f\u0131 diren\u00e7 g\u00f6sterecek \u015fekilde tasarlan\u0131r. Ana i\u015flevi, arabay\u0131 ve kancay\u0131 desteklemek ve araban\u0131n kiri\u015f boyunca d\u00fczg\u00fcn bir \u015fekilde hareket etmesi i\u00e7in hassas y\u00fck konumland\u0131rmas\u0131 sa\u011flayan bir ray sa\u011flamakt\u0131r.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"end-girder\">Son Kiri\u015f<\/h3>\n\n\n\n<p>U\u00e7 kiri\u015f, ana kiri\u015fin her iki ucunu birbirine ba\u011flar ve t\u00fcm vin\u00e7 yap\u0131s\u0131n\u0131 destekler. Genellikle vincin her iki taraf\u0131nda bulunur ve t\u00fcm sistemin pist raylar\u0131 boyunca hareket etmesini sa\u011flar. U\u00e7 kiri\u015fler tahrik \u00fcniteleri veya seyahat tekerlekleri ile donat\u0131lm\u0131\u015ft\u0131r ve vincin seyahat mekanizmas\u0131na ba\u011flanarak ray boyunca istikrarl\u0131 hareket sa\u011flar. Tasar\u0131mlar\u0131, y\u00fcksek y\u00fckler alt\u0131nda g\u00fc\u00e7 ve dayan\u0131kl\u0131l\u0131\u011fa odaklanarak vincin genel stabilitesi ve manevra kabiliyetinde \u00f6nemli bir rol oynar.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"cabin\">Kabin<\/h3>\n\n\n\n<p>bu <a href=\"https:\/\/www.hndfcrane.com\/tr\/crane-operator-cabins\/\">kabin<\/a> operat\u00f6r\u00fcn vinci kontrol etti\u011fi yerdir. Genellikle ana kiri\u015fin alt\u0131na as\u0131l\u0131r veya \u00e7al\u0131\u015fma alan\u0131n\u0131n net bir \u015fekilde g\u00f6r\u00fclebildi\u011fi bir konuma yerle\u015ftirilir. Kabin iyi g\u00f6r\u00fc\u015f ve g\u00fcvenlik i\u00e7in tasarlanm\u0131\u015ft\u0131r. Hassas kald\u0131rma ve hareket i\u015flemleri i\u00e7in bir kontrol konsolu veya kam kontrol\u00f6r\u00fc ile donat\u0131lm\u0131\u015ft\u0131r. Operat\u00f6r konforunu sa\u011flamak i\u00e7in kabin genellikle yorgunlu\u011fu azaltmak ve g\u00fcvenli\u011fi ve verimlili\u011fi art\u0131rmak i\u00e7in klima, havaland\u0131rma ve ergonomik bir koltuk ve d\u00fczen i\u00e7erir. Kabine eri\u015fim genellikle y\u00fcr\u00fcy\u00fc\u015f yoluna ba\u011fl\u0131 dikey veya e\u011fimli merdivenler arac\u0131l\u0131\u011f\u0131yla sa\u011flan\u0131r.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"overhead-crane-traveling-mechanism\">K\u00f6pr\u00fcl\u00fc Vin\u00e7 Hareket Mekanizmas\u0131<\/h2>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"960\" height=\"640\" src=\"https:\/\/www.hndfcrane.com\/wp-content\/uploads\/2025\/06\/Traveling-mechanism-overhead-crane-part.png\" alt=\"\" class=\"wp-image-12037\"\/><\/figure>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"wheels\">tekerlekler<\/h3>\n\n\n\n<p><a href=\"https:\/\/www.hndfcrane.com\/tr\/crane-wheels\/\">Vin\u00e7 tekerlekleri<\/a> seyahat mekanizmas\u0131n\u0131n temel bile\u015fenleridir, genellikle u\u00e7 kiri\u015flerin alt\u0131na monte edilirler. Raylar boyunca uzan\u0131rlar ve vincin t\u00fcm a\u011f\u0131rl\u0131\u011f\u0131n\u0131 desteklerler. \u0130ki ana t\u00fcr\u00fc vard\u0131r: vincin raylar boyunca ilerlemesini sa\u011flayan tahrik tekerlekleri ve d\u00fczg\u00fcn hareket etmesine yard\u0131mc\u0131 olan bo\u015f tekerlekler. Bu tekerlekler genellikle a\u011f\u0131r y\u00fckler ve s\u0131k hareket alt\u0131nda a\u015f\u0131nma ve darbe direnci i\u00e7in y\u00fcksek mukavemetli ala\u015f\u0131ml\u0131 \u00e7elikten yap\u0131l\u0131r. Tasar\u0131mlar\u0131 ray a\u015f\u0131nmas\u0131n\u0131 dikkate al\u0131r ve hem tekerlekler hem de raylar i\u00e7in d\u00fczg\u00fcn \u00e7al\u0131\u015fma, d\u00fc\u015f\u00fck g\u00fcr\u00fclt\u00fc ve uzun hizmet \u00f6mr\u00fc sa\u011flamak i\u00e7in hassas i\u015fleme ve ayarlama i\u00e7erir.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"motor\">Motor<\/h3>\n\n\n\n<p>Seyahat motoru, vin\u00e7 k\u00f6pr\u00fcs\u00fcn\u00fcn ve troleyinin raylar boyunca yatay hareketini sa\u011flar. Elektrik enerjisini mekanik harekete d\u00f6n\u00fc\u015ft\u00fcrerek do\u011fru ve d\u00fczg\u00fcn bir seyahat sa\u011flar. Genellikle bir di\u015fli kutusuyla birle\u015ftirilen motorun y\u00fcksek h\u0131zl\u0131 d\u00f6n\u00fc\u015f\u00fc, daha y\u00fcksek torklu daha d\u00fc\u015f\u00fck bir h\u0131za d\u00fc\u015f\u00fcr\u00fcl\u00fcr ve vin\u00e7 hareketi s\u0131ras\u0131nda yeterli \u00e7eki\u015f ve denge sa\u011flar.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"reducer\">red\u00fckt\u00f6r<\/h3>\n\n\n\n<p>Red\u00fckt\u00f6r, motor ve tekerlekler aras\u0131ndaki \u00f6nemli bir iletim bile\u015fenidir. Motorun y\u00fcksek h\u0131zl\u0131 \u00e7\u0131k\u0131\u015f\u0131n\u0131, sabit vin\u00e7 \u00e7al\u0131\u015fmas\u0131 i\u00e7in uygun d\u00fc\u015f\u00fck h\u0131zl\u0131, y\u00fcksek torklu bir \u00e7\u0131k\u0131\u015fa d\u00fc\u015f\u00fcr\u00fcr. Birden fazla di\u015fli kademesi arac\u0131l\u0131\u011f\u0131yla, vincin raylar boyunca d\u00fczg\u00fcn bir \u015fekilde hareket etmesi i\u00e7in yeterli \u00e7ekme kuvveti sa\u011flar. Y\u00fcksek mukavemetli, a\u015f\u0131nmaya dayan\u0131kl\u0131 malzemelerden \u00fcretilen red\u00fckt\u00f6r, s\u0131k \u00e7al\u0131\u015ft\u0131rma, durdurma ve de\u011fi\u015fen y\u00fckler alt\u0131nda uzun hizmet \u00f6mr\u00fc i\u00e7in tasarlanm\u0131\u015ft\u0131r. Hassas bir di\u015fli oran\u0131, d\u00fczg\u00fcn \u00e7al\u0131\u015ft\u0131rma, durdurma ve konumland\u0131rma sa\u011flar.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"brake\">Fren<\/h3>\n\n\n\n<p>bu <a href=\"https:\/\/www.hndfcrane.com\/tr\/overhead-crane-brakes\/\">fren<\/a> vincin raylar \u00fczerinde g\u00fcvenilir bir \u015fekilde durmas\u0131n\u0131 sa\u011flayan kritik bir g\u00fcvenlik cihaz\u0131d\u0131r. Genellikle motorun \u00e7\u0131k\u0131\u015f miline monte edilir ve mekanik veya elektromanyetik kuvvetle \u00e7al\u0131\u015f\u0131r. Frenleme gerekti\u011finde, vincin do\u011fru bir \u015fekilde durdurulmas\u0131 ve ataletten kaynaklanan kontrols\u00fcz hareketin \u00f6nlenmesi i\u00e7in h\u0131zla kuvvet uygular. A\u015f\u0131nmaya dayan\u0131kl\u0131 malzemelerden \u00fcretilen fren, a\u011f\u0131r hizmet tipi ve s\u0131k \u00e7al\u0131\u015ft\u0131rma-durdurma ko\u015fullar\u0131 i\u00e7in tasarlanm\u0131\u015ft\u0131r ve genellikle a\u015f\u0131r\u0131 \u0131s\u0131nma korumas\u0131 ve uzun s\u00fcreli kullan\u0131mda etkili frenlemeyi s\u00fcrd\u00fcrmek i\u00e7in otomatik ayarlama \u00f6zelli\u011fine sahiptir.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"coupling\">Ba\u011flant\u0131<\/h3>\n\n\n\n<p>Kaplin, motoru di\u015fli kutusuna veya di\u015fli kutusunu tekerleklere ba\u011flar. Torku iletir ve ba\u011fl\u0131 \u015faftlar aras\u0131ndaki hafif hizalama hatalar\u0131n\u0131 telafi eder. Vin\u00e7 uygulamalar\u0131nda, kaplinler ayr\u0131ca \u00e7al\u0131\u015fma s\u0131ras\u0131nda \u015foklar\u0131 ve titre\u015fimleri emerek \u015fanz\u0131man bile\u015fenlerini korur ve daha p\u00fcr\u00fczs\u00fcz g\u00fc\u00e7 iletimi sa\u011flar.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"overhead-crane-hoisting-mechanism-hoists-and-trolleys\">K\u00f6pr\u00fcl\u00fc Vin\u00e7 Kald\u0131rma Mekanizmas\u0131 (Vin\u00e7ler ve Arabalar)<\/h2>\n\n\n\n<p>K\u00f6pr\u00fcl\u00fc vin\u00e7lerde yayg\u0131n kald\u0131rma ara\u00e7lar\u0131 aras\u0131nda palangalar ve a\u00e7\u0131k vin\u00e7 arabalar\u0131 bulunur. <a href=\"https:\/\/www.hndfcrane.com\/tr\/single-girder-overhead-cranes\/\">Tek kiri\u015fli k\u00f6pr\u00fcl\u00fc vin\u00e7ler<\/a> genellikle vin\u00e7ler kullan\u0131l\u0131rken, <a href=\"https:\/\/www.hndfcrane.com\/tr\/double-girder-overhead-cranes\/\">\u00e7ift kiri\u015fli k\u00f6pr\u00fcl\u00fc vin\u00e7ler<\/a> Elektrikli vin\u00e7ler veya a\u00e7\u0131k vin\u00e7 arabalar\u0131 aras\u0131ndan se\u00e7im yapabilirsiniz.<\/p>\n\n\n\n<p>Vin\u00e7 vin\u00e7leri, arabalarla e\u015fle\u015ftirilerek vincin ana kiri\u015fine monte edilir ve y\u00fcklerin dikey kald\u0131r\u0131lmas\u0131 ve yatay hareketi i\u00e7in kullan\u0131labilir. Yayg\u0131n vin\u00e7 tipleri aras\u0131nda manuel zincirli vin\u00e7ler, tel halatl\u0131 elektrikli vin\u00e7ler ve elektrikli zincirli vin\u00e7ler bulunur. Elektrikli vin\u00e7ler, daha fazla kald\u0131rma kuvveti ve daha h\u0131zl\u0131 \u00e7al\u0131\u015fma verimlili\u011fi sa\u011flayarak y\u00fcksek verimlilik ve s\u0131k operasyonlar i\u00e7in uygundur; manuel vin\u00e7ler, basit operasyon ve d\u00fc\u015f\u00fck bak\u0131m maliyetleriyle hafif y\u00fckler veya hassas operasyonlar i\u00e7in kullan\u0131l\u0131r. Tel halatl\u0131 elektrikli vin\u00e7ler, daha h\u0131zl\u0131 h\u0131za ve daha d\u00fczg\u00fcn, daha sessiz \u00e7al\u0131\u015fmaya sahiptir ve 10 ton ve \u00fczeri kald\u0131rma kapasiteleri i\u00e7in pazara hakimdir. Tel halatl\u0131 elektrikli vin\u00e7lerle kar\u015f\u0131la\u015ft\u0131r\u0131ld\u0131\u011f\u0131nda, elektrikli zincirli vin\u00e7ler daha dayan\u0131kl\u0131 zincirlere sahiptir, daha az yer kaplar ve daha uygun fiyatl\u0131d\u0131r, genellikle 5 tonun alt\u0131ndaki hafif uygulamalar i\u00e7in kullan\u0131l\u0131r.<\/p>\n\n\n\n<p>A\u00e7\u0131k vin\u00e7 arabalar\u0131 iki ana kiri\u015f aras\u0131na monte edilir ve nesneleri kald\u0131rmak i\u00e7in bir kasnak sistemi ve tel halat kullan\u0131r. Verimli motorlar ve red\u00fckt\u00f6rlerle donat\u0131lm\u0131\u015f olup g\u00fc\u00e7l\u00fc \u00e7eki\u015f ve sabit kald\u0131rma h\u0131z\u0131 sa\u011flarlar. Geleneksel vin\u00e7 tipi kald\u0131rma cihazlar\u0131yla kar\u015f\u0131la\u015ft\u0131r\u0131ld\u0131\u011f\u0131nda, a\u00e7\u0131k vin\u00e7 arabalar\u0131 daha a\u011f\u0131r y\u00fckleri ve daha y\u00fcksek kald\u0131rma gereksinimlerini kald\u0131rabilir.<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"900\" height=\"601\" src=\"https:\/\/www.hndfcrane.com\/wp-content\/uploads\/2025\/06\/overhead-crane-trolley.png\" alt=\"\" class=\"wp-image-12033\"\/><\/figure>\n\n\n\n<p>Bir k\u00f6pr\u00fcl\u00fc vin\u00e7 kald\u0131rma mekanizmas\u0131n\u0131n ana bile\u015fenleri \u015funlard\u0131r:<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"sheaves\">Demetler<\/h3>\n\n\n\n<p>Makaralar, tel halat\u0131 y\u00f6nlendirmek i\u00e7in kullan\u0131lan kald\u0131rma mekanizmas\u0131ndaki kritik bile\u015fenlerdir. Tel halat\u0131n y\u00f6n\u00fcn\u00fc ve y\u00fck ta\u015f\u0131ma kapasitesini de\u011fi\u015ftirerek, makaralar kald\u0131rma y\u00fck\u00fcn\u00fc etkili bir \u015fekilde payla\u015f\u0131r ve vincin kald\u0131rma kapasitesini art\u0131r\u0131r. \u0130ki t\u00fcr makara vard\u0131r: tel halat\u0131n hareketinin y\u00f6n\u00fcn\u00fc de\u011fi\u015ftiren sabit makaralar ve y\u00fck ile birlikte hareket ederek gerekli \u00e7ekme kuvvetini azaltan hareketli makaralar.<\/p>\n\n\n\n<p>Bir kasna\u011f\u0131n d\u0131\u015f kenar\u0131, tel halat\u0131 s\u0131k\u0131ca tutmak ve kaymay\u0131 veya a\u015f\u0131nmay\u0131 \u00f6nlemek i\u00e7in bir oluk ile tasarlanm\u0131\u015ft\u0131r. Bir blokta d\u00fczenlenmi\u015f birden fazla kasnak, vincin y\u00fck kapasitesini art\u0131r\u0131rken gerekli motor g\u00fcc\u00fcn\u00fc azaltabilir. Kasnak bloklar\u0131, verimli kald\u0131rma i\u015flemleri elde etmek i\u00e7in temel bile\u015fenlerdir.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"hooks\">Kancalar<\/h3>\n\n\n\n<p><a href=\"https:\/\/www.hndfcrane.com\/tr\/crane-hooks\/\">Vin\u00e7 kancalar\u0131<\/a> y\u00fckleri ba\u011flamak ve ta\u015f\u0131mak i\u00e7in kullan\u0131l\u0131r, genellikle y\u00fcksek mukavemetli ala\u015f\u0131ml\u0131 \u00e7elikten yap\u0131l\u0131r ve \u00e7al\u0131\u015fma s\u0131ras\u0131nda kazara y\u00fck serbest kalmas\u0131n\u0131 \u00f6nlemek i\u00e7in emniyet mandallar\u0131yla donat\u0131lm\u0131\u015ft\u0131r. Kancalar genellikle tek veya \u00e7ift kanca olarak tasarlan\u0131r; tek kancalar hafif ila orta y\u00fckler i\u00e7in uygundur, \u00e7ift kancalar ise daha a\u011f\u0131r y\u00fckleri daha e\u015fit \u015fekilde da\u011f\u0131tmaya yard\u0131mc\u0131 olarak dengeyi ve g\u00fcvenli\u011fi art\u0131r\u0131r. Ayr\u0131ca, kancalar 360 derece d\u00f6nebilir, y\u00fcklerin farkl\u0131 a\u00e7\u0131lardan ta\u015f\u0131nmas\u0131n\u0131 kolayla\u015ft\u0131r\u0131r ve operasyonel esnekli\u011fi art\u0131r\u0131r. Kancalar\u0131n yan\u0131 s\u0131ra, \u00fcstten \u00e7al\u0131\u015fan vin\u00e7ler ayr\u0131ca a\u015fa\u011f\u0131dakiler gibi di\u011fer kald\u0131rma ata\u015fmanlar\u0131n\u0131 da kullanabilir: <a href=\"https:\/\/www.hndfcrane.com\/tr\/15-different-grab-buckets-for-crane-applications\/\">kovalar\u0131 kapmak<\/a> ve uygulamaya ba\u011fl\u0131 olarak elektromanyetik kald\u0131r\u0131c\u0131lar.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"motors\">motorlar<\/h3>\n\n\n\n<p>Kald\u0131rma motoru, kald\u0131rma g\u00fcc\u00fc sa\u011flayan temel bile\u015fendir. Genellikle a\u011f\u0131r y\u00fckleri kald\u0131rma ve indirme taleplerini kar\u015f\u0131lamak i\u00e7in y\u00fcksek hassasiyetle y\u00fcksek tork ve d\u00fc\u015f\u00fck h\u0131z i\u00e7in tasarlanm\u0131\u015ft\u0131r. Motor, y\u00fck alt\u0131nda sorunsuz ba\u015flatma ve yeterli kald\u0131rma kuvveti sa\u011flamak i\u00e7in g\u00fc\u00e7l\u00fc bir ba\u015flang\u0131\u00e7 torku sa\u011flamal\u0131d\u0131r. Motorlar genellikle de\u011fi\u015fken frekansl\u0131 s\u00fcr\u00fcc\u00fcler veya h\u0131z kontrol sistemleri i\u00e7erir ve operat\u00f6rlerin kald\u0131rma h\u0131z\u0131n\u0131 hassas bir \u015fekilde kontrol etmelerine, konumland\u0131rma do\u011frulu\u011funu ve operasyonel esnekli\u011fi iyile\u015ftirmelerine olanak tan\u0131r.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"reducers\">Red\u00fckt\u00f6rler<\/h3>\n\n\n\n<p>Red\u00fckt\u00f6r, motor ve tamburu birbirine ba\u011flayarak \u00f6nemli bir iletim bile\u015feni g\u00f6revi g\u00f6r\u00fcr. Ana i\u015flevi, motorun y\u00fcksek h\u0131zl\u0131 d\u00f6n\u00fc\u015f\u00fcn\u00fc a\u011f\u0131r y\u00fckleri kald\u0131rmaya uygun d\u00fc\u015f\u00fck h\u0131zl\u0131, y\u00fcksek torklu \u00e7\u0131k\u0131\u015fa d\u00f6n\u00fc\u015ft\u00fcrmek ve b\u00f6ylece d\u00fczg\u00fcn ve do\u011fru y\u00fck kald\u0131rma sa\u011flamakt\u0131r. Red\u00fckt\u00f6rler genellikle \u00e7ok a\u015famal\u0131 di\u015fli iletimi kullan\u0131r, kald\u0131rma i\u015flemleri s\u0131ras\u0131nda gerekli g\u00fcc\u00fc sa\u011flamak i\u00e7in torku art\u0131r\u0131rken h\u0131z\u0131 kademeli olarak azalt\u0131r.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"brakes\">frenler<\/h3>\n\n\n\n<p>Kald\u0131rma mekanizmas\u0131ndaki frenler, kald\u0131rma veya indirme s\u0131ras\u0131nda y\u00fck\u00fc kontrol eder ve tutar ve kontrols\u00fcz y\u00fck ini\u015fini \u00f6nler. Genellikle motor veya red\u00fckt\u00f6r \u00e7\u0131k\u0131\u015f miline tak\u0131l\u0131rlar. Kald\u0131rma durdu\u011funda veya acil durumlarda, fren y\u00fck\u00fc konumunda sabit tutmak i\u00e7in h\u0131zla kuvvet uygular ve operasyonel g\u00fcvenli\u011fi sa\u011flar.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"drums\">Davullar<\/h3>\n\n\n\n<p>bu <a href=\"https:\/\/www.hndfcrane.com\/tr\/crane-rope-drum\/\">vin\u00e7 halat\u0131 tamburu<\/a> tel halat\u0131n sar\u0131l\u0131p a\u00e7\u0131ld\u0131\u011f\u0131, kancan\u0131n veya di\u011fer kald\u0131rma aparatlar\u0131n\u0131n dikey hareketini kontrol eden bile\u015fendir. Tambur y\u00fczeyinde, tel halat\u0131n sar\u0131lma s\u0131ras\u0131nda d\u00fczg\u00fcn bir \u015fekilde hizalanmas\u0131n\u0131 sa\u011flayan oluklar bulunur, kaymay\u0131 veya \u00fcst \u00fcste binmeyi \u00f6nler, bu da tel halat\u0131n hizmet \u00f6mr\u00fcn\u00fc uzatmaya ve a\u015f\u0131nmay\u0131 azaltmaya yard\u0131mc\u0131 olur.<\/p>\n\n\n\n<p>Tamburlar, hassas kald\u0131rma kontrol\u00fc i\u00e7in red\u00fckt\u00f6rler arac\u0131l\u0131\u011f\u0131yla motorlara ba\u011flan\u0131r. Boyutlar\u0131, oluk derinlikleri ve e\u011fimleri, tel halat \u00f6zelliklerine ve vin\u00e7 tasar\u0131m y\u00fck\u00fcne g\u00f6re optimize edilir. Tamburlar ayr\u0131ca \u015funlar\u0131 i\u00e7erir: <a href=\"https:\/\/www.hndfcrane.com\/tr\/overhead-crane-rope-guides\/\">halat k\u0131lavuzlar\u0131<\/a> D\u00fczenli sar\u0131m\u0131 korumak ve dola\u015fmay\u0131 \u00f6nlemek i\u00e7in. Tamburun d\u00fczg\u00fcn tasar\u0131m\u0131 ve bak\u0131m\u0131, vincin d\u00fczg\u00fcn \u00e7al\u0131\u015fmas\u0131 ve g\u00fcvenli kald\u0131rma i\u00e7in kritik \u00f6neme sahiptir.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"wire-ropes\">Tel Halatlar<\/h3>\n\n\n\n<p>Tel halatlar, kald\u0131rma mekanizmas\u0131nda y\u00fckleri ta\u015f\u0131yan ve kald\u0131ran temel bile\u015fenlerdir. Kancay\u0131, kasnak blo\u011funu ve tamburu birbirine ba\u011flayarak tambura sar\u0131larak kald\u0131rma ve indirmeyi m\u00fcmk\u00fcn k\u0131larlar. Tel halatlar, vincin uygulamas\u0131na ba\u011fl\u0131 olarak \u00e7ap, \u00e7ekme dayan\u0131m\u0131 ve korozyon direnci bak\u0131m\u0131ndan farkl\u0131l\u0131k g\u00f6sterir; d\u0131\u015f mekan vin\u00e7leri korozyona dayan\u0131kl\u0131 halatlar kullanabilir. A\u015f\u0131nma, kopmu\u015f teller ve deformasyon tel halat g\u00fcvenli\u011fini etkiler, bu nedenle g\u00fcvenli ve g\u00fcvenilir kald\u0131rma i\u015flemleri sa\u011flamak i\u00e7in d\u00fczenli inceleme ve bak\u0131m gereklidir.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"overhead-crane-electrical-and-control-systems\">K\u00f6pr\u00fcl\u00fc Vin\u00e7 Elektrik ve Kontrol Sistemleri<\/h2>\n\n\n\n<p>Elektrik kontrol sistemi nispeten karma\u015f\u0131kt\u0131r ve temel olarak a\u015fa\u011f\u0131daki par\u00e7alardan olu\u015fur:<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"busbar\">Bara<\/h3>\n\n\n\n<p>Bara, k\u00f6pr\u00fc vin\u00e7leri i\u00e7in ana g\u00fc\u00e7 kayna\u011f\u0131 y\u00f6ntemidir. Genellikle vin\u00e7 pistinin bir taraf\u0131na monte edilir ve bak\u0131r veya al\u00fcminyumdan yap\u0131lm\u0131\u015f bir dizi paralel iletken raydan olu\u015fur. Bara, hareket ettik\u00e7e k\u00f6pr\u00fcye ve troleylere s\u00fcrekli g\u00fc\u00e7 sa\u011flar ve t\u00fcm elektrikli cihazlar\u0131n kesintisiz \u00e7al\u0131\u015fmas\u0131n\u0131 sa\u011flar.<\/p>\n\n\n\n<p>Bara sistemi raylar\u0131, kollekt\u00f6rleri ve yal\u0131t\u0131m braketlerini i\u00e7erir. Kollekt\u00f6rler k\u00f6pr\u00fc veya troley \u00fczerine monte edilir, elektri\u011fi toplamak ve vincin motorlar\u0131na ve kontrol cihazlar\u0131na iletmek i\u00e7in bara boyunca kayar. Yal\u0131t\u0131m braketleri baray\u0131 yerinde sabitler ve s\u0131z\u0131nt\u0131y\u0131 \u00f6nlemek ve g\u00fcvenli\u011fi sa\u011flamak i\u00e7in yap\u0131dan izole eder.<\/p>\n\n\n\n<p>G\u00fc\u00e7 stabilitesini etkileyebilecek kollekt\u00f6rlerin zay\u0131f temas\u0131 veya atlamas\u0131 gibi durumlar\u0131n \u00f6n\u00fcne ge\u00e7mek i\u00e7in bara tasar\u0131m\u0131nda ve montaj\u0131nda hassas hizalama gereklidir.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"power-supply-cable\">G\u00fc\u00e7 Kayna\u011f\u0131 Kablosu<\/h3>\n\n\n\n<p>G\u00fc\u00e7 kayna\u011f\u0131 <a href=\"https:\/\/www.hndfcrane.com\/tr\/overhead-crane-cables\/\">kablo<\/a> esas olarak vincin elektrikli kald\u0131rma tertibat\u0131na veya vin\u00e7 arabas\u0131na, s\u00fcr\u00fc\u015f sistemine ve kontrol sistemine istikrarl\u0131 elektrik sa\u011flar. Kablolar genellikle vincin iskeleti veya arabas\u0131 \u00fczerinde d\u00fczenlenir, kayar raylar veya kablo ta\u015f\u0131y\u0131c\u0131lar\u0131 taraf\u0131ndan y\u00f6nlendirilir ve kablolar\u0131n \u00e7al\u0131\u015fma s\u0131ras\u0131nda \u00e7ekilmeden veya hasar g\u00f6rmeden k\u00f6pr\u00fc veya araba ile serbest\u00e7e hareket etmesini sa\u011flar.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"control\">Kontrol<\/h3>\n\n\n\n<p>K\u00f6pr\u00fcl\u00fc vin\u00e7ler \u00e7e\u015fitli kontrol y\u00f6ntemleri kullanabilir. Ana tipler aras\u0131nda operat\u00f6r kabini kontrol\u00fc, uzaktan kumanda ve ask\u0131 kontrol\u00fc bulunur:<\/p>\n\n\n\n<ul>\n<li>Operat\u00f6r Kabini Kontrol\u00fc: Vin\u00e7 \u00fczerine, genellikle ana kiri\u015fin alt\u0131nda veya troley yak\u0131n\u0131nda as\u0131l\u0131 duran ba\u011f\u0131ms\u0131z bir kabin monte edilir. Operat\u00f6r, t\u00fcm vin\u00e7 i\u015flevlerini (k\u00f6pr\u00fc hareketi, troley hareketi ve kald\u0131rma) kontrol konsollar\u0131 ve kam kontrol\u00f6rleri arac\u0131l\u0131\u011f\u0131yla i\u00e7eriden kontrol eder. Kabin, kald\u0131rma alan\u0131n\u0131n iyi bir g\u00f6r\u00fcn\u00fcm\u00fcn\u00fc sa\u011flayarak hassas kontrol sa\u011flar. Bu y\u00f6ntem karma\u015f\u0131k, y\u00fcksek y\u00fckl\u00fc kald\u0131rma g\u00f6revlerine uygundur ve g\u00fcvenlik ve do\u011fruluk sa\u011flar.<\/li>\n\n\n\n<li>Uzaktan Kumanda: Kablosuz radyo sinyallerini kullan\u0131r ve operat\u00f6r\u00fcn vincin yerden elde ta\u015f\u0131nan bir uzaktan kumandayla kontrol etmesini sa\u011flar. Bu y\u00f6ntem b\u00fcy\u00fck esneklik sunar ve g\u00fcvenli bir mesafeden \u00e7al\u0131\u015ft\u0131rmaya olanak tan\u0131r, s\u0131n\u0131rl\u0131 g\u00f6r\u00fc\u015f alan\u0131 veya tehlikeli ortamlar i\u00e7in idealdir. \u0130\u015flevler genellikle ba\u015flatma, durdurma, h\u0131zland\u0131rma, yava\u015flatma ve yukar\u0131\/a\u015fa\u011f\u0131 kald\u0131rmay\u0131 i\u00e7erir ve g\u00fcvenli\u011fi ve rahatl\u0131\u011f\u0131 art\u0131r\u0131r.<\/li>\n\n\n\n<li>Pendant Kontrol\u00fc: Operat\u00f6r\u00fcn vin\u00e7 veya kald\u0131rma ekipman\u0131n\u0131n yak\u0131n\u0131nda as\u0131l\u0131 bir kontrol kutusu (pendant) kulland\u0131\u011f\u0131 kablolu bir kontrol y\u00f6ntemidir. Pendant, kald\u0131rma, indirme, ileri ve geri gibi temel hareketler i\u00e7in birden fazla d\u00fc\u011fmeye sahiptir. K\u0131sa mesafeli hareketler ve basit i\u015flemler i\u00e7in uygundur, kullan\u0131m kolayl\u0131\u011f\u0131 ve \u00e7ok y\u00f6nl\u00fcl\u00fck sunar. Pendant kontrol\u00fc, operat\u00f6r\u00fcn y\u00fck\u00fc yak\u0131ndan g\u00f6zlemlemesini ve ekipman\u0131 do\u011frudan kontrol etmesini sa\u011flar, hassas kald\u0131rma g\u00f6revleri i\u00e7in uygundur.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"overhead-crane-rail-system\">K\u00f6pr\u00fcl\u00fc Vin\u00e7 Ray Sistemi<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"rails\">Raylar<\/h3>\n\n\n\n<p>Raylar, genellikle binan\u0131n her iki taraf\u0131ndaki y\u00fck ta\u015f\u0131yan kiri\u015flere monte edilen bir k\u00f6pr\u00fc vincinin d\u00fczg\u00fcn hareketini destekleyen temel bile\u015fenlerdir. Y\u00fcksek mukavemetli \u00e7elikten \u00fcretilen raylar, vincin ve y\u00fck\u00fcn\u00fcn ta\u015f\u0131nmas\u0131 i\u00e7in iyi a\u015f\u0131nma ve darbe direnci sunar. Yayg\u0131n tipler aras\u0131nda y\u00fck ve ortama g\u00f6re se\u00e7ilen \u00e7elik raylar ve I kiri\u015fler bulunur. Kurulum s\u0131ras\u0131nda hassas hizalama, sapma veya titre\u015fim olmadan sabit vin\u00e7 hareketi sa\u011flar. Hizmet \u00f6mr\u00fcn\u00fc uzatmak i\u00e7in gerekti\u011finde temizlik, ya\u011flama veya de\u011fi\u015ftirme ile paralellik, a\u015f\u0131nma ve sabitleme i\u00e7in d\u00fczenli kontroller esast\u0131r. Do\u011fru ray kurulumu ve bak\u0131m\u0131, vincin g\u00fcvenli ve verimli \u00e7al\u0131\u015fmas\u0131 i\u00e7in hayati \u00f6nem ta\u015f\u0131r.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"runway-beam\">Pist Kiri\u015fi<\/h3>\n\n\n\n<p>Pist kiri\u015fi, vin\u00e7 raylar\u0131n\u0131 ve \u00e7al\u0131\u015fmas\u0131n\u0131 destekler, genellikle bina s\u00fctunlar\u0131na veya ba\u011f\u0131ms\u0131z desteklere monte edilir. Hareket s\u0131ras\u0131nda vincin a\u011f\u0131rl\u0131\u011f\u0131n\u0131, y\u00fck\u00fcn\u00fc ve dinamik kuvvetlerini ta\u015f\u0131yabilecek yeterli mukavemete ve sertli\u011fe sahip olmal\u0131d\u0131r. Kiri\u015f, d\u00fczg\u00fcn vin\u00e7 hareketi sa\u011flayarak sabit bir yol sa\u011flar. Genellikle y\u00fcksek mukavemetli \u00e7elik veya betondan yap\u0131l\u0131r, d\u00fczg\u00fcn ve d\u00fcz raylar\u0131 korumak i\u00e7in hassas bir \u015fekilde hizalan\u0131r ve sabitlenir, b\u00fck\u00fclme veya d\u00fczensiz \u00e7\u00f6kmeden kaynaklanan dengesizli\u011fi \u00f6nler. Pist kiri\u015finin uygun tasar\u0131m\u0131, kurulumu ve bak\u0131m\u0131, g\u00fcvenli ve g\u00fcvenilir vin\u00e7 operasyonu i\u00e7in temeldir.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"overhead-crane-safety-protection-devices\">K\u00f6pr\u00fcl\u00fc Vin\u00e7 G\u00fcvenlik Koruma Cihazlar\u0131<\/h2>\n\n\n\n<p><a href=\"https:\/\/www.hndfcrane.com\/tr\/posts\/overview-of-common-safety-devices-for-overhead-cranes-and-gantry-cranes\/\">G\u00fcvenlik koruma cihazlar\u0131<\/a> k\u00f6pr\u00fc vin\u00e7lerinde, ekipman\u0131n g\u00fcvenli bir \u015fekilde \u00e7al\u0131\u015fmas\u0131n\u0131 sa\u011flamak, operat\u00f6rleri korumak ve hasar\u0131 \u00f6nlemek i\u00e7in hayati \u00f6nem ta\u015f\u0131r. Yayg\u0131n g\u00fcvenlik cihazlar\u0131 ve i\u015flevleri \u015funlard\u0131r:<\/p>\n\n\n\n<ul>\n<li>Acil G\u00fc\u00e7 Kesme Anahtar\u0131: Acil durumlarda vincin ana g\u00fc\u00e7 ve kontrol devrelerini h\u0131zla keser, genellikle da\u011f\u0131t\u0131m dolab\u0131nda bulunur.<\/li>\n\n\n\n<li>Uyar\u0131 Zili: Ayak pedal\u0131 arac\u0131l\u0131\u011f\u0131yla \u00e7al\u0131\u015fma uyar\u0131lar\u0131 sa\u011flar.<\/li>\n\n\n\n<li>A\u015f\u0131r\u0131 Y\u00fck S\u0131n\u0131rlay\u0131c\u0131: Kald\u0131rma mekanizmas\u0131na monte edilir; y\u00fck, nominal kapasitesinin 90%&#39;sine ula\u015ft\u0131\u011f\u0131nda alarm verir ve 105% a\u015f\u0131r\u0131 y\u00fckte otomatik olarak g\u00fcc\u00fc keser.<\/li>\n\n\n\n<li>\u00dcst S\u0131n\u0131r Pozisyon Korumas\u0131: Kanca \u00fcst s\u0131n\u0131r\u0131na ula\u015ft\u0131\u011f\u0131nda g\u00fcc\u00fc otomatik olarak kesen kald\u0131rma mekanizmas\u0131ndaki bir s\u0131n\u0131r cihaz\u0131.<\/li>\n\n\n\n<li>Seyahat Limit Anahtar\u0131: K\u00f6pr\u00fc ve tramvay y\u00fcr\u00fcy\u00fc\u015f mekanizmalar\u0131n\u0131n her iki taraf\u0131na monte edilir; y\u00fcr\u00fcy\u00fc\u015f limitlerine ula\u015f\u0131ld\u0131\u011f\u0131nda elektri\u011fi keser ve ters y\u00f6nde harekete izin verir.<\/li>\n\n\n\n<li>Ayd\u0131nlatma: Operat\u00f6rler i\u00e7in yeterli g\u00f6r\u00fc\u015f alan\u0131 ve \u00e7evredeki alan i\u00e7in g\u00fcvenlik sa\u011flayarak d\u00fc\u015f\u00fck \u0131\u015f\u0131kl\u0131 ortamlarda (\u00f6rne\u011fin gece veya i\u00e7 mekanlarda) g\u00fcvenli \u00e7al\u0131\u015fmay\u0131 garanti eder.<\/li>\n\n\n\n<li>Tampon: Vincin metal yap\u0131s\u0131n\u0131n ucuna yerle\u015ftirilen ve \u00e7arp\u0131\u015fma enerjisini emerek darbeyi azaltan bir g\u00fcvenlik cihaz\u0131.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"we-are-overhead-crane-parts-suppliers\">Biz K\u00f6pr\u00fcl\u00fc Vin\u00e7 Par\u00e7alar\u0131 Tedarik\u00e7isiyiz<\/h2>\n\n\n\n<p>Bir k\u00f6pr\u00fc vincinin her bile\u015feninin istikrarl\u0131 ve verimli bir \u015fekilde \u00e7al\u0131\u015fmas\u0131n\u0131 sa\u011flamak esast\u0131r, \u00e7\u00fcnk\u00fc her biri performans\u0131 ve g\u00fcvenli\u011fi do\u011frudan etkiler.
